Warning Signs You Need Window Leak Water Damage Restoration

Don’t ignore these warning signs – they can save you thousands of dollars in repairs. Catching water damage early can prevent bigger problems and reduce the risk of mold growth. Don’t wait until it’s too late.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a musty smell in your home, it could be a sign of water damage. This can be caused by mold growth, which can spread quickly and cause serious health issues. Don’t ignore the smell – address it right away.

Warped or Buckled Wood

Water damage can cause wood to warp or buckle, which can lead to further damage and even collapse. If you notice any signs of warping or buckling, contact us immediately. We’ll help you prevent a bigger disaster.

Window Leak Water Damage Restoration Cost in Taylorsville, UT

The cost of window leak water damage restoration can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Taylorsville, UT. These estimates are based on average prices and may vary depending on your specific situation. Contact us for a free estimate.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Planning $100 – $500 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, amount of water involved
Repair and Replacement $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, materials required
Final Inspection and Touch-ups $100 – $500 Size of affected area, complexity of repairs
Emergency Services (after hours or weekends) $200 – $1,000 Severity of damage, time of day/week
Travel fees (for remote locations) $100 – $500 Distance from our office, travel time
